Position Summary:
We are se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ented Dental Assistant (I and II) to join our team. The ideal candidate will assist the dental team in providing high-quality pediatric patient care and ensure the smooth operation of the dental office.
Key Responsibilities
- Ensure that all operatories are ready for patients prior to clinic hours/end of day
- Proficiency in 4-handed dentistry, prioritizing patient comfort
- Prepare and sterilize instruments and dental equipment.
- Take and process dental X-rays (with proper certification).
- Perform basic lab tasks, such as pouring and trimming dental models.
- Take impressions of patients' teeth for study models or orthodontic appliances.
- Apply fluoride treatments and sealants (if qualified and permitted).
- Perform coronal polishing (if qualified and permitted)
- Accurately record all medical/dental findings, results and outcomes in the EHR (Epic Wisdom) in accordance with HIPAA guidelines
- Sequence and appoint comprehensive treatment plans in Wisdom
- Provide post-operative care instructions to patients.
- Ensure infection control by following OSHA and CDC guidelines.
Administrative Responsibilities
- Schedule and confirm patient appointments in Wisdom according to effective scheduling policies.
- Maintain and update patient records.
- Assist with billing, insurance claims, and payment processing.
- Order and manage dental supplies and inventory.
- Greet and check in patients, ensuring a smooth office workflow.
